This print captures the exquisite interior of the Pazzi Chapel, a masterpiece created by the renowned Italian architect Filippo Brunelleschi. Located within the serene cloister of the Basilica of S. Croce in Florence, this architectural gem showcases elements from various styles and periods including Early Renaissance, Renaissance-Baroque, and Europe's rich history spanning over a millennium. The photograph was taken around 1890, allowing us to glimpse into this timeless work of art that was completed between 1429 and 1470. With its symmetrical design and harmonious proportions, Brunelleschi's genius is evident in every detail. The chapel's elegant arches soar towards the heavens while delicate light filters through intricately carved windows, creating an ethereal atmosphere that invites contemplation. As we admire this image captured by Brogi from Alinari, we are transported back in time to witness firsthand the artistic brilliance that defined Florence during its golden age. The Pazzi Chapel stands as a testament to human creativity and devotion—a sacred space where Christian worshipers have sought solace for centuries.
